TDIV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2019 in Review

130 of the 4,560 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in First Trust NASDAQ Technology Dividend Index Fund (TDIV) for Q3 2019, worth a combined $407M — up 4.3% from $391M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 14 funds opened new TDIV positions and 12 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 49 added to existing stakes and 38 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BB&T Securities, adding an estimated $8.95M.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$6.17M.
